The Downtown Morning Market is Coming Back!
After a winter break and some uncertainty about its future, the city has confirmed that the Downtown Morning Market will return on Saturday, March 7th! You can look forward to over 30 vendors, including local farmers, bakers, and artisans offering fresh produce, prepared foods, and handmade goods. During the winter hiatus, the city surveyed nearby businesses to understand the market's impact. The results? About a third of surrounding businesses saw a positive impact from the market, with increased visibility and new customers. The city says they'll continue evaluating operations to best serve residents, customers, vendors, and nearby businesses. If you're a vendor interested in participating, applications are being accepted on an ongoing basis. Visit the city's website for more information. Show Your Redlands Pride: T-Shirt Design Contest is On!
Calling all artists and creative minds! The 5th Annual Redlands T-shirt Design Contest is underway, and this is your chance to design the next official Redlands t-shirt. Hosted by the Redlands Visitor Center, the contest is open to current residents of Redlands, Yucaipa, Mentone, Highland, and Loma Linda. The deadline for submissions is February 19th, with the winner announced on February 24th. Your design will be judged on authenticity in depicting Redlands, creativity in execution, and representation of our city. The winning design will be printed and sold - typically over 500 shirts! So get your creative juices flowing and show us what you've got. Submit your designs at the Redlands Visitor Center at 14 N. Fifth Street. |

Don't miss out - visit the city's website for more information. Sad news for crafters: the Joann store at 1625 W. Lugonia Avenue is closing as part of a nationwide bankruptcy affecting around 500 stores. If you're a regular shopper there, now's the time to check out any final sales before they close their doors.
